## Runbook: LargeDiff viewer stalls

LargeDiff renders diffs for files over 50MB by chunking server-side. If the viewer hangs, check chunk worker health first — most stalls are exhausted workers, not client issues. Restarting workers is safe; in-flight diffs resume from the last chunk. Do not raise the file-size ceiling without sign-off from the Osprey platform team; memory limits are tight. Worker pool and chunking settings for prod follow.

settings of tagef-bawif:
DRUIX_HOST=druix.zemvarlabs.internal
DRUIX_PORT=8000

## Deployment: LinkLattice Router

LinkLattice resolves mobile deep links for the Marrowgate app suite. Deployments are blue-green: the release manager promotes a candidate only after the route-table diff passes review and the canary serves 5% of traffic for two hours without resolution errors. Rollback swaps the alias, so no rebuild is needed. Each promoted build must ship with the configuration values listed below.

deployment values, yadug-bawif:
[framir]
team = pelox
access_code = ac_a38ab2
owner = tamion.julael
host = framir.tolvaqlabs.test
port = 11211
peer = tammir.zemvargrid.local
salt = 2215ef03
pin = 1541

- [ ] Step 7: Archive cold storage buckets (Glacierline tier). Confirm both ceremony witnesses are present, verify bucket manifests match the Oxbow ledger, then seal the archive key shares. Plugin authors may observe but not handle shares. Once sealed, the archive index itself is encrypted and can only be reopened with the passphrase below.

vault phrase of badup-hahig = tamael-aldael-kelmir-istael-fenok-istwyn-tamius-jorath-oliion

## Configuration: Log Sampling

The Larkwire ingest service emits roughly 40k log lines per minute at peak, so sampling is mandatory in production. Set `LARKWIRE_LOG_SAMPLE_RATE` to a float between 0.01 and 1.0; security-relevant events (auth failures, policy denials) bypass sampling unconditionally and are always written in full. Sampled-out lines are counted and reported so reviewers can verify nothing is silently dropped. The sampler also signs its audit stream, which requires a signing secret in the environment file, on the next line.

sealed setting: RELAY_SECRET5=82864